Minerva Networks Inc.


 


LabSystem

 

Minerva IP Television Lab System is a complete end-to-end IP Television Headend that allows network operators to streamline and evaluate the complex process of testing and deploying interactive television services prior to full commercial deployment. The Minerva IP Television Lab includes all of the components needed to test your network and to evaluate a broad range of services prior to full commercial deployment. An IP Television Headend is the central point of subscriber management, media aggregation, and distribution of video services over high-speed broadband IP networks. Minerva IP Television Lab is a compact IP Television Headend connected via a broadband network to NTSC or PAL set-top boxes. This fully integrated solution includes an application server (running Minerva® iTVManager management software), a video server, a high-performance 100Base-T Ethernet switch, and a video acquisition subsystem. Depending on customers¹ preferences, the video acquisition sub-system can be configured with either analog MPEG-2 carrier class encoders or DVB-to-IP demultiplexers for digital turn-around of satellite signals.

The Minerva IP Television Lab can be expanded to accommodate a full IP Television deployment.


TV BOOK
Minerva ® TVBook is a complete, portable and cost effective IP Television simulation system that enables testing and evaluation of advanced television services over any broadband IP network.

TVBookincludes Minerva® iTVManager, Minerva's television services management software, and Kasenna'sMedia Base video server software, preloaded with two hours of content. Both iTVManager and Media Base come pre-installed and pre-configured on a powerful notebook PC weighing less than eight pounds. TVBook is designed for broadband network operators, equipment manufacturers, engineering consulting firms and systems integrators who need a simple, low-cost solution to evaluate and demonstrate a variety of IP Television services.This complete headend simulation system supports the streaming of four channels of programming to up to five STBs. TVBook can be used to deliver a broad range of video services including live TV, VOD, NVOD and PPV.
